Abstract:
Contours of a surface of a bearing which extends about an axis are displayed on a grid. To visualize the contours, points on the surface are measured at a plurality of angular positions to determine the corresponding measured values. The measured values at each angular position are normalized to determine a normalized measurement datum corresponding to each angular position. The normalized measurement datum is subtracted from each of the measured values to determine a plurality of deviations of the corresponding points. Shades are assigned that correspond to a range of possible deviations. Each of the deviations are displayed as a data segment on a grid that represents the shape of the surface of the bearing. Each data segment is shaded on the grid to the corresponding shade to provide a topographical representation of the contours of the surface of the bearing.

Abstract:
A chatter boundary system includes a measuring module, a comparison module, and a boundary module. The measuring module measures and collects samples of undulations in a manufactured part. The comparison module classifies a sound signal generated by the undulations as either noisy or quiet. The boundary module determines a continuous boundary between the noisy and quiet undulations based on the samples and the sound signal.

Abstract:
A method for shaping a workpiece having a base portion using a tool is provided. The method includes rotating the tool at a fixed rotational speed in a first direction and rotating the workpiece in the first direction. The tool is positioned in contact with the workpiece at a first portion of the base portion of the workpiece. The workpiece is rotated at a first rotational speed when the tool contacts the first portion of the base portion of the workpiece. The workpiece is rotated at a second rotational speed when the tool contacts a second portion of the base portion of the workpiece. The first rotational speed and the second rotational speed are different.

Abstract:
A sliding camshaft for shifting to a selected one of a plurality of selectable cam lobes includes an inner shaft and an outer shaft. The inner shaft has an external spline. The outer shaft has an inner surface, an outer surface, a coating, and an outer portion. The inner surface is subjectable to wear and is configured with an internal spline for transferring torque from and sliding axially on the external spline of the inner shaft. The outer surface is subjectable to wear and loading and is configured with the plurality of selectable cam lobes. The coating on the inner surface is for wear resistance. The outer portion is case hardened for wear resistance of the outer surface and to create a compressive residual stress in the outer portion for load carrying capability.
